UL Cyberpark, Palazhi Road, UL Cyberpark, Nellikode, Kozhikode, 673016
Since : 2013
1st Floor Mar Thimotheous Church, Kannur Road, Opposite Anona Supermarket, Nadakkavu, Kozhikode, 673011
Since : 2014
Idukki, Nadakkavu
Idukki, Nellikode
Idukki, Nellikode
Idukki, Nadakkavu
Latest Customer Reviews
"Ontime service and dedicated staffs"
"Good Service"